OpenLDAP正在运行和笔记本电脑,因为笔记本电脑的电池电量没有持续,并且WIndows 7 OS关闭。重新启动WIndows 7操作系统后,尝试启动OpenLDAP并获得以下错误。
试图查看互联网/谷歌搜索中是否有任何锁定或任何类型的信息,但没有一个给出好的回复。
53021aca backend_startup_one: starting "dc=my-domain,dc=com"
53021aca bdb_db_open: "dc=my-domain,dc=com"
53021aca bdb_db_open: database "dc=my-domain,dc=com": unclean shutdown detected; attempting recovery.
53021aca bdb_db_open: database "dc=my-domain,dc=com": dbenv_open(../var/openldap-data).
53021aca bdb_db_open: database "dc=my-domain,dc=com": alock_recover failed
53021aca ====> bdb_cache_release_all
53021aca bdb_db_close: database "dc=my-domain,dc=com": alock_close failed
53021aca backend_startup_one (type=bdb, suffix="dc=my-domain,dc=com"): bi_db_open failed! (-1)
53021aca slapd shutdown: initiated
53021acb ====> bdb_cache_release_all
53021acb bdb_db_close: database "dc=my-domain,dc=com": alock_close failed
53021acb slapd destroy: freeing system resources.
53021acb slapd stopped.
以上是来自OpenLDAP服务器的日志...
OpenLDAP正在运行和笔记本电脑,因为笔记本电脑的电池电量没有持续,并且WIndows 7 OS关闭。重新启动WIndows 7操作系统后,尝试启动OpenLDAP并获得以下错误。
试图查看互联网/谷歌搜索中是否有任何锁定或任何类型的信息,但没有一个给出好的回复。
答案 0 :(得分:4)
用完全相同的错误日志解决了我自己的问题。
转到LDAP安装的direcotry / var / openldap-data
应该有一个名为alock
的文件。删除此文件。启动LDAP。
不客气。
选择正在运行的dos窗口并键入CTRL-C,服务器将停止,您将被提示终止批处理作业?,在此提示符下键入y将关闭窗口。
如果未遵循此程序(例如您关闭了PC 在没有终止LDAP服务器的情况下,服务器可能会 随后拒绝开始。如果是这种情况导航到 目录c:\ openldap \ var \ run并删除此目录中的所有文件 (slapd.args和slapd.pid)。服务器现在应该重新启动。失败 这看一下日志文件(默认在\ var \ log中)。